What does BL-13 Fei Shu do?

Fei Shu BL-13 is the Back-Shu point of the Lungs — the place on the back where the Lung's qi is said to infuse the body surface — and it is the principal point of the back for the Lung in every one of its aspects: its qi, its yin, its heat and its relation to the exterior of the body. Sacred Lotus sources & references record that classification directly, and it is the single fact that organises everything else about this point. Where a treatment intends to reach the Lung as an organ from the back, BL-13 is the point that does it.

  • Tonifies Lung qi and nourishes Lung yin — the defining action, recorded first in our own action record. It covers the weak, breathless, easily-tired presentation the tradition attributes to Lung qi deficiency, and the dry, hot, night-sweating presentation it attributes to Lung yin deficiency. That one point serves both is characteristic of the Back-Shu points: they reach the organ rather than a particular aspect of it.
  • Descends and disseminates Lung qi — the action that governs breathing itself. In classical theory the Lung both spreads qi outward to the surface and sends it downward; when that downward movement fails, qi is said to rebel upward, and the result is cough and wheezing. This is the point that carries "descends rebellious Lung qi" in channel theory, by virtue of its Back-Shu classification — a phrase that circulates attached to points which have no channel basis for it, discussed under the notes below.
  • Clears heat from the Lung — for the productive, hot, thick-phlegm presentations and for the recorded indications of coughing blood, tidal fever and bone-steaming heat.
  • Releases the exterior — the Lung is said to govern the defensive qi at the body surface, so its Back-Shu point is used at the beginning of an external invasion as well as in chronic organ disease. This is the action BL-13 shares with its immediate neighbour Feng Men BL-12, and the two are constantly used together.
  • Benefits the skin and body hair — the classical correspondence. The Lung is said to govern the skin and hair (fei zhu pi mao), which is the reasoning behind the point's long-standing use in itching, rash and chronic skin complaints as well as in respiratory ones.
  • Regulates the water passages of the upper burner — the Lung is described as the "upper source of water", and BL-13 carries the recorded use for oedema of the face and upper body and for difficulty in the passage of fluids.

Why does the Back-Shu classification matter?

The Back-Shu points are the tradition's most direct route to an internal organ. Each is understood as the place where that organ's qi infuses the back, which gives them two roles: they are used to treat the organ, particularly in chronic and deficient conditions, and they are palpated in diagnosis, since tenderness, a sunken feeling or a change in the tissue at a Back-Shu point is read as a sign that its organ is involved. BL-13 is the first and highest of the twelve, and it is among the most used of the whole group — partly because respiratory complaints are common, and partly because the Lung, being the organ the tradition places closest to the exterior, is implicated in a very large share of acute illness as well as chronic.

What is BL-13 Fei Shu used for?

Fei Shu BL-13 is used above all for cough and wheezing — it is the single most frequently selected point in the published acupuncture literature on asthma — and after that for the chest, for heat and night sweating from deficiency, and for the skin. The indications carried in Sacred Lotus sources & references are cough, asthma, chest pain, spitting of blood, afternoon fever and night sweating; the standard reference literature sets them out more fully below. These describe traditional use, not proven treatment, and this point carries the pneumothorax caution set out under needling.

  • Cough, chronic cough and dry cough
  • Wheezing, asthma and shortness of breath
  • Breathlessness on exertion and weak, shallow breathing
  • Fullness or pain in the chest
  • Spitting or coughing of blood
  • Afternoon (tidal) fever and bone-steaming heat
  • Night sweating and spontaneous sweating
  • Common cold with fever, chills and body ache
  • Nasal congestion and runny nose
  • Sore, dry or hoarse throat and loss of voice
  • Stiffness and aching of the upper back and between the shoulder blades
  • Itching, rash and chronic skin complaints
  • Aversion to cold and repeated susceptibility to colds
  • Vomiting of foam or thin fluid, and phlegm that is hard to expel

Where is BL-13 Fei Shu, and how is it used in practice?

Fei Shu lies high on the upper back, one and a half cun either side of the midline, level with the lower border of the spinous process of the third thoracic vertebra — that is, level with Shen Zhu DU-12 on the spine itself. Sacred Lotus sources & references give it in both terms. It is a bilateral point, needled on both sides, and it sits in the muscle mass beside the spine at the level of the upper part of the shoulder blades, high in the band of the back that lies directly over the lung.

In practice BL-13 is used in two registers that are worth keeping apart. As a Back-Shu point it is reached for in chronic Lung patterns — deficiency of qi or yin, lingering cough, wheezing that returns every winter — usually with its Front-Mu point on the chest and a distal Lung-channel point. As an exterior-releasing point it is used at the onset of a cold or an asthma attack, in company with Feng Men BL-12 above it and Da Zhui DU-14 on the midline. It is also one of the points most often treated without a needle at all: moxibustion, cupping and the summer herbal plaster tradition all centre on this part of the back.

Which points is BL-13 combined with?

  • With Zhong Fu LU-01 — the Front-Mu point of the Lungs, on the upper chest below the outer end of the collarbone. Back-Shu with Front-Mu is the classical Shu-Mu pairing for reaching an organ from front and back at once, and this is its Lung instance. Both points are held in this library, and both lie over the thorax and carry the same family of depth considerations.
  • With Tai Yuan LU-09 — the Yuan-Source point of the Lung channel at the wrist, and additionally the Hui-Meeting point of the vessels. Back-Shu with Yuan-Source is the classical pairing for supplementing an organ.
  • With Feng Men BL-12 — one level above at T2, the "Wind Gate". BL-12 is chosen when a pathogen is arriving; BL-13 addresses the Lung itself. In practice the two are needled together so routinely that they function almost as a single point.
  • With Ding Chuan and Da Zhui DU-14 — the upper-back grouping for wheezing. A data-mining analysis of 183 controlled clinical trials of acupuncture for asthma found Feishu BL-13 to be the most frequently used point of all, ahead of Dingchuan, Dazhui, Shenshu BL-23, Pishu BL-20 and Fengmen BL-12, and identified BL-13, BL-12 and Ding Chuan as the central nodes of the combination network (Shang PP et al., Complement Med Res 2022;29(2):136–146, PMID 34875661).
  • With Pi Shu BL-20 and Shen Shu BL-23 — the classical three-organ structure for chronic wheezing: free the Lung qi while supporting Spleen and Kidney, treating the symptom and the root together. The same data-mining analysis flagged this exact grouping as a priority combination, and it is the protocol used in the summer point-application tradition.
  • With Gao Huang Shu BL-43 — three cun lateral and one level below on the outer Bladder line, the great point of the upper back for chronic depletion. BL-13 with BL-43 is the standard pairing for long-standing Lung deficiency and was the pairing used in the experimental work on pulmonary fibrosis noted under the BL-43 record.
  • With Lie Que LU-07 and He Gu LI-04 — the distal pair for releasing the exterior, added at the onset of a cold.
  • With Chi Ze LU-05 and Kong Zui LU-06 — the He-Sea and Xi-Cleft points of the Lung channel on the forearm, for acute cough and for coughing blood respectively.
  • With Po Hu BL-42 — "Po Door", on the outer Bladder line three cun lateral at the same T3 level, the outer companion of BL-13 and the point associated with the po, the corporeal soul the Lung is said to house.

Where does BL-13 sit among the Back-Shu points?

The Back-Shu points run down the inner Bladder line, one and a half cun either side of the spine, one for each organ, in roughly the order the organs sit in the trunk. Sacred Lotus sources & references hold the complete set of twelve, and they are worth seeing together because the arrangement is the point:

  • Fei Shu BL-13 — Lungs
  • Jue Yin Shu BL-14 — Pericardium
  • Xin Shu BL-15 — Heart
  • Gan Shu BL-18 — Liver
  • Dan Shu BL-19 — Gallbladder
  • Pi Shu BL-20 — Spleen
  • Wei Shu BL-21 — Stomach
  • San Jiao Shu BL-22 — San Jiao
  • Shen Shu BL-23 — Kidneys
  • Da Chang Shu BL-25 — Large Intestine
  • Xiao Chang Shu BL-27 — Small Intestine
  • Pang Guang Shu BL-28 — Bladder

BL-13 is the highest of the twelve, which matches the position of the organ: the Lung sits at the top of the trunk and the tradition calls it the "canopy" over the other organs. Each Back-Shu point pairs with its organ's Front-Mu point on the front of the trunk, and the full set of twelve Front-Mu points is held here as well:

  • Zhong Fu LU-01 — Lungs
  • Shan Zhong REN-17 — Pericardium
  • Ju Que REN-14 — Heart
  • Qi Men LIV-14 — Liver
  • Ri Yue GB-24 — Gallbladder
  • Zhang Men LIV-13 — Spleen
  • Zhong Wan REN-12 — Stomach
  • Shi Men REN-05 — San Jiao
  • Jing Men GB-25 — Kidneys
  • Tian Shu ST-25 — Large Intestine
  • Guan Yuan REN-04 — Small Intestine
  • Zhong Ji REN-03 — Bladder

The Lungs are one of the few organs whose Front-Mu point sits on its own channel: Zhong Fu LU-01 is both the Lung's Front-Mu point and the first point of the Lung channel. That is not the rule — our own records show the Kidneys' Front-Mu on the Gall Bladder channel at Jing Men GB-25, the Spleen's at Zhang Men LIV-13 on the Liver channel, and the Pericardium's at Shan Zhong REN-17 on the Conception Vessel — which makes the Lung pairing the easiest of the twelve to learn and the one most often used to teach the Shu-Mu structure.

How is BL-13 Fei Shu needled, and what is the pneumothorax risk?

Stated plainly: BL-13 lies over the thorax beside the third thoracic vertebra, with the upper lobe of the lung directly beneath it, and pneumothorax — a punctured lung — is the documented hazard at this point and at every point in the band it belongs to. The reference texts do not record a perpendicular insertion here. Our own record specifies oblique insertion of 0.5 to 0.7 inch, and the angle is the substance of the record, not a stylistic detail. Everything below is recorded as neutral reference data describing what the textbooks and the published anatomical studies state. It is not instruction, this page does not teach technique, and needling is carried out only by a qualified, licensed practitioner.

The angle and depth the texts record

  • Sacred Lotus sources & references record oblique insertion of 0.5 to 0.7 inch, with moxibustion applicable — the same bounded figure our records give for Feng Men BL-12 above it, for Ge Shu BL-17 below it and for Pi Shu BL-20 further down the same line.
  • Deadman & Al-Khafaji (p. 267) and Chinese Acupuncture & Moxibustion (p. 177) record oblique insertion directed medially, toward the spine, in a comparable range, and both attach an explicit caution against deep or laterally angled insertion at the thoracic Shu points because of the lung beneath. Angling toward the vertebral column keeps the needle in the muscle mass with bone behind it; angling outward points it at the intercostal space and the pleura behind that.
  • Moxibustion, cupping and herbal point application are all recorded at this point and are extremely common at it. None of them carries the pneumothorax hazard, which is one reason the upper back is so often treated without needles at all — and why the largest body of clinical research on BL-13 concerns plasters and moxa rather than needling.
  • For comparison within our own records: the 0.5–0.7 inch recorded at BL-13 is bounded in the same way as the 0.3–0.5 inch given for GB-21 over the apex of the lung, and considerably shallower than the 1–1.2 inch given for BL-23 in the lumbar region below the ribs. Depth figures in this literature track the structure underneath, not the size of the region.

The measured anatomy — and what each study actually measured

  • A CT study that measured BL-13 itself. This is the point-specific finding. A retrospective study measured, directly from chest CT images, the safe needling depth at 23 upper-back acupoints in 319 patients aged 4 to 18 (205 boys, 114 girls), defining safe depth as the distance from the skin surface of the point to the pleura. The 23 points were DU-09 to DU-14, BL-11 to BL-17, BL-41 to BL-46, SI-14, SI-15, GB-21 and SP-21. The measured depth at Fei Shu BL-13 was 28.54 ± 7.08 mm in boys and 26.41 ± 5.38 mm in girls, a difference that was significant at this point (P = 0.003). Across the five age bands the depth at BL-13 rose from 24.82 ± 2.74 mm at ages 4 to 6 to 30.68 ± 8.04 mm at ages 16 to 18 (P < 0.001), and it rose with body size as well — from 26.25 ± 4.70 mm in the lightest weight band to 33.51 ± 12.84 mm in the heaviest, and from 26.09 ± 4.78 mm in the underweight body-mass-index group to 33.22 ± 12.10 mm in the obese one. Multiple regression identified weight as the single most important determinant at all 23 points (Ma YC et al., BMC Complement Altern Med 2016;16:85, PMID 26922245, PMC4769822, DOI 10.1186/s12906-016-1060-x). State the limits precisely: these are children and adolescents drawn from a single Taiwanese hospital population, all of them patients rather than healthy children, and the figure is the distance at which the pleura is reached — not a recommended needling depth.
  • Why that figure is worth reading twice. Two and a half to three centimetres, in a child, is the entire margin, and a standard deviation of seven millimetres in boys means individual children differed from one another by more than the whole textbook insertion range. BL-13 was also one of the points at which boys and girls did differ significantly — unlike the lateral points on the same list — which is consistent with the depth here tracking the paravertebral muscle mass rather than the tissue over the shoulder blade.
  • Honest limit on the adult figure. No imaging study measuring a safe needling depth at BL-13 in adults could be located, and none is quoted. For adults, what is recorded here is the bounded depth and specified angle the reference texts give, together with the measured anatomy of the surrounding region — with every measurement attributed to the point at which it was actually made.
  • Cadaveric mapping of the pleural dome. A dissection study of 46 adult bodies mapped the dome of the pleura against the commonly used points around it, naming Da Zhu BL-11 — the Bladder-channel point two levels above Fei Shu, in the same band — explicitly alongside Tian Tu REN-22, Jian Jing GB-21, Qi She ST-11 and Ding Chuan EX-B1. The projection of the pleural dome varied widely between individuals, extending beyond the medial third of the clavicle in almost 60 per cent of bodies. The authors' conclusion is the operative one: when a point is located and angled as the standard describes the pleura is not reached, but exceeding the recorded depth breaches the pleural membrane (Chen Y et al., Zhongguo Zhen Jiu 2006;26(5):346–8, PMID 16739850). That study named BL-11, not BL-13; the two sit two vertebral levels apart on the same line, and the finding is cited for the region rather than as a measurement of this point.
  • How thin the tissue actually is over the lung apex. The nearest directly measured figure in this region comes from Jian Jing GB-21, a short distance laterally on the shoulder: ultrasonography in 101 adults measured the depth from skin to the pleural line at 17.4 mm in men and 14.6 mm in women on average, increasing with weight, height and body mass index (Lin S-K et al., J Acupunct Meridian Stud 2018;11(6):355–360, PMID 29936338, DOI 10.1016/j.jams.2018.06.004). That figure is for GB-21, not for Fei Shu, and it is offered as the measured scale of the region rather than as a number for this point — but it makes the essential fact concrete: over the shoulder girdle and upper back, a centimetre and a half can be the whole of the margin.
  • Adult back depths, measured as a region. A CT study of 120 patients, grouped by weight, height and sex, measured the distance from the skin of the back to the thoracic pleura at the relevant acupuncture locations and defined that distance as the safe depth. Depths did not differ significantly between the sexes but differed highly significantly between body-size groups (P < 0.01) (Zhong Xi Yi Jie He Za Zhi 1991;11(1):10–13, PMID 2054884), with a companion study doing the same for the chest (Zhonghua Yi Xue Za Zhi (Taipei) 1992;50(5):388–99, PMID 1338010). Neither abstract names BL-13 among the points measured.
  • No single agreed safe depth exists for any point. Two systematic reviews of the safe-depth literature — 33 studies in the first, 47 in the second, measured by MRI, CT, ultrasound and cadaveric dissection — both concluded that depths measured for the same point differ greatly between subject groups and measuring methods, and that the definition of "safe depth" has never been standardised (J Altern Complement Med 2011;17(3):199–206, PMID 21417806; Evid Based Complement Alternat Med 2013;2013:740508, PMID 23935678). A textbook depth figure describes an average body, not a constant.
  • What lies beneath, in plain terms. At the T3 level the needle passes through skin, subcutaneous tissue, trapezius and rhomboid, then the erector spinae mass beside the vertebra. In front of those lie the third and fourth ribs and, between them, the intercostal space with the parietal pleura and the upper lobe of the lung immediately behind it. There is no bony floor here in the way there is over the scapula or the occiput. That is the whole anatomical reason for the recorded medial angle and shallow depth.

What is documented, and how often

Pneumothorax is the second most frequently reported serious adverse event in acupuncture. A systematic review of the Chinese case-report literature from 1956 to 2010 identified 1,038 adverse-event cases across 167 articles, of which 307 were pneumothorax — behind only fainting. Thirty-five deaths were recorded across the whole series, and the authors attributed the events chiefly to improper technique, concluding that most were avoidable through standardised training (He W et al., J Altern Complement Med 2012;18(10):892–901, PMID 22967282). A companion systematic review of 115 Chinese-language articles reporting 479 adverse events including 14 deaths reached the same conclusion about traumatic complications (Zhang J et al., Bull World Health Organ 2010;88(12):915–921C, PMID 21124716, PMC2995190). The presentation is not always immediate: an emergency-medicine case report describes a healthy 38-year-old woman who developed pleuritic chest pain the day after dry needling of the back, with bedside ultrasound showing absent lung sliding and a lung point on the right (Cureus 2021;13(3):e14207, PMID 33948398, PMC8086747). Fatal cases exist: an autopsy report describes bilateral pneumothoraces following electroacupuncture, the authors noting that electrical pulses and the muscle contraction they cause may draw needles deeper than the depth at which they were inserted (J Forensic Sci 2022;67(1):377–383, PMID 34435369). A pneumothorax after needling over the thorax or upper back may declare itself hours later, with sudden chest pain, breathlessness or a persistent dry cough; it is a medical emergency requiring immediate assessment.

The proportion of the risk

A meta-analysis of prospective clinical studies estimated serious adverse events in acupuncture at approximately 1 per 10,000 patients and around 8 per million treatments, with about half of all recorded events being bleeding, pain or flare at the needle site, placing acupuncture among the safer treatments in medicine (Bäumler P et al., BMJ Open 2021;11:e045961, PMID 34489268, DOI 10.1136/bmjopen-2020-045961). Both facts belong together: the overall rate is low, and the events that do occur concentrate in the small band of points over the lung to which Fei Shu belongs. The bounded oblique depth exists to keep it that way.

What does the name Fei Shu mean?

Fei Shu means "Lung Shu" — fei, the Lungs, and shu, a transport point. The character shu carries the sense of conveying or transporting, and the Back-Shu points are named for exactly that: the places on the back where each organ's qi is said to be transported to the body surface. Sacred Lotus sources & references translate the name as Lung Shu and classify the point as the Back-Shu of the Lungs. The name is a description of the point's function rather than a metaphor, which sets the twelve Back-Shu points apart from most of the repertoire and makes them among the easiest names in acupuncture to learn.

Is BL-13 the point that "descends rebellious Lung qi"?

Yes — and it is worth saying so explicitly, because the phrase attaches itself to other points that have no channel basis for it. "Descends rebellious Lung qi" is a statement of channel and organ theory: it asserts that a point acts on the Lung organ and on the direction of its qi. Only a point with a channel or classification relationship to the Lung can carry it. The extra point Ding Chuan, beside Da Zhui on the upper back, is the clearest case of the phrase circulating where it does not belong: Ding Chuan is a genuinely useful and heavily used point for wheezing, but it lies on no channel, holds no five-shu, yuan, luo, xi-cleft, back-shu or front-mu classification, and has no channel connection to the Lung organ. Our own record for Ding Chuan previously carried the claim and it has been removed; the action belongs to BL-13 Fei Shu, whose Back-Shu classification is precisely a statement that it reaches the Lung organ. This page is the other half of that correction. What Ding Chuan's sources actually document is the clinical result — wheezing calmed — and that is what its record now says. A reader who arrived searching for "the point that descends rebellious Lung qi" has arrived at the right one.

Is there research on BL-13 Fei Shu?

BL-13 is the most frequently selected point in the published acupuncture literature on asthma, and it is one of the very few points at which a physiological measurement has been taken at the point itself and correlated with organ disease. The honest summary is that the point-specific research is measurement research and point-selection research rather than efficacy research: no adequately powered sham-controlled trial isolates BL-13.

  • Blood perfusion measured at BL-13 itself. In a rat model of chronic obstructive pulmonary disease, blood perfusion at the body surface was measured at Feishu BL-13 and compared with control non-acupoints and with Taichong LIV-03, Yanglingquan GB-34 and Zusanli ST-36 through the onset, establishment and recovery of the disease. Perfusion at BL-13 rose as the disease progressed and fell as it recovered, and it correlated more closely with the lung pathology — mean linear intercept, bronchitis score, interleukin-1β and interleukin-6 — than perfusion at any of the comparison points. The authors propose it as a possible early-warning marker (Yang HM et al., J Integr Med 2026;24(2):238–252, PMID 40713362, DOI 10.1016/j.joim.2025.07.003). It is an animal study, but the design is unusual and directly relevant: it tests the classical claim that a Back-Shu point reflects its organ, and it tests it against other points rather than against nothing.
  • Skin temperature at BL-13 in human asthma. Sixty-one patients with chronic persistent asthma were divided by lung-function level, and the skin surface temperature was measured at bilateral Feishu BL-13, Geshu BL-17, Pishu BL-20 and Shenshu BL-23. Temperature at all four points was higher in the reduced-lung-function group and was negatively correlated with forced vital capacity, forced expiratory volume in one second, the FEV1/FVC ratio and peak expiratory flow, all expressed as percentages of predicted (Zhongguo Zhen Jiu 2025;45(3):274–279, PMID 40097207). Sixty-one people and an observational design — but again a direct test of the diagnostic half of the Back-Shu idea, in humans, at this point.
  • Point-selection analysis, where BL-13 comes first. A data-mining study of 183 controlled clinical trials of acupuncture for asthma found Feishu BL-13 the most frequently prescribed point, ahead of Dingchuan, Dazhui, Shenshu, Pishu and Fengmen, with BL-13 among the central nodes of the point-combination network; cluster analysis recovered the treatment principle of freeing the Lung qi while supporting Spleen and Kidney (Shang PP et al., Complement Med Res 2022;29(2):136–146, PMID 34875661, DOI 10.1159/000521346). This measures what practitioners and trialists have chosen, not whether it worked.
  • The largest trial in which the point is a variable. Four hundred and fifty-six patients with asthma were randomised to three different point prescriptions for summer herbal point application over the years 2015 to 2019, one of which used Feishu BL-13, Xinshu BL-15 and Geshu BL-17. Attack frequency and total serum IgE fell in all three groups; two of the three prescriptions outperformed the third, and the authors' conclusion was that which points were chosen, and not how long the plaster was left on, determined the effect (J Tradit Chin Med 2023;43(1):146–153, PMID 36640006, PMC9924751). A large study, and one of the few that varies the point selection deliberately — but it compares prescriptions against each other rather than against a sham.
  • Preclinical mechanism work. A rat study applied a mustard-seed-based ointment at Feishu BL-13, Pishu BL-20 and Shenshu BL-23 in an ovalbumin asthma model and traced the anti-inflammatory effect to suppression of autophagy through the AMPK/mTOR pathway, confirmed by blocking AMPK (J Asthma 2026;63(1):15–25, PMID 40920042). A three-point animal protocol, recorded for completeness rather than as evidence about the point in humans.

What is missing should be said plainly: there is no sham-controlled randomised trial of BL-13 alone for asthma, cough or any other of its principal uses. Every clinical study that names it uses it inside a prescription, so the results describe the prescription. The point's standing rests on the classical record, on its overwhelming frequency of selection, and on a small amount of measurement taken at the point itself.

How does BL-13 compare with the points around it?

Feng Men BL-12 lies one level above at T2 and is the exterior point — chosen when a pathogen is arriving — while Fei Shu addresses the Lung organ itself. The two are constantly used together and are the pair most often confused. Jue Yin Shu BL-14 at T4 and Xin Shu BL-15 at T5 continue the line below, for the Pericardium and the Heart. Da Zhu BL-11 sits two levels above at T1, is the Hui-Meeting point of the bones, and is directed at bone and the upper spine rather than at the Lung. Po Hu BL-42 is BL-13's outer companion three cun lateral at the same level, associated with the corporeal soul the Lung is said to house. Gao Huang Shu BL-43 lies just below it on that outer line and is the great point of the upper back for chronic depletion; where BL-13 addresses the Lung, BL-43 addresses depletion in general. Zhong Fu LU-01 on the upper chest is BL-13's Front-Mu counterpart, and Tai Yuan LU-09 at the wrist its distal Yuan-Source partner. And Ding Chuan, the extra point beside Da Zhui, is the symptomatic wheezing point of the same region — genuinely useful, but not a Lung-organ point, which is the distinction set out above. Every point in this band shares the pneumothorax caution recorded under needling.
